Travel Information from Santiago de Compostela to Porto

Distance119 miles (192 km)
Available travel modesTrain or bus
Ticket price range$20 - $28
Cheapest modeBus • $20 (€18) • 3 h 25 min
Fastest modeBus • $20 (€18) • 3 h 25 min
Popular travel companiesAlsa or Renfe Viajeros

Travel 119 miles (192 km) by train or bus from Santiago de Compostela to Porto. The most popular travel companies which serve this trip are Alsa or Renfe Viajeros among others. Travelers can even take a direct bus or train from Santiago de Compostela to Porto.

You can get to Porto from Santiago de Compostela 2 different ways: train or bus.

The cheapest way to get from Santiago de Compostela to Porto is by taking a bus with average ticket prices of $20 (€18) compared to other travel options to Porto:

Taking a bus costs $8 (€7) less than taking a train, which average ticket prices of $28 (€25).

The quickest way to travel between Santiago de Compostela and Porto is by bus, which takes on average 3 h 25 min   compared to other travel options that take longer:

Train takes on average 4 h 8 min.

You should expect to travel around 119 miles (192 km) between Santiago de Compostela and Porto.

The average frequency per day from Santiago de Compostela to Porto is:

  • 10 buses per day.
  • Around 1 train per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your journey between Santiago de Compostela and Porto as scheduled services by train or bus can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Santiago de Compostela to Porto:

  • Buses most often depart from Santiago de Compostela at Santiago de Compostela, Estación de Autobuses and arrive in Porto at Porto, Aeroporto Francisco Sá Carneiro.

The following travel companies offer services from Santiago de Compostela to Porto:

  • Travel with Alsa, BlaBlaCar Bus, FlixBus or MonBus for buses to Porto. If you’re looking for a good deal on tickets, check for BlaBlaCar Bus Santiago de Compostela to Porto tickets on Omio for $20 (€18).
  • Travel with Renfe Viajeros for trains to Porto. If you’re looking for a good deal on tickets, check for Renfe Viajeros Santiago de Compostela to Porto tickets on Omio for $28 (€25).

Yes, there are direct routes from Santiago de Compostela to Porto with the following travel companies:

  • You can check for a direct bus to Porto with Alsa, BlaBlaCar Bus or FlixBus with 8 direct buses per day.
